Parenchyma, collenchyma, and sclerenchyma form the ground tissue system in plants Web15 jan. 2024 · The primary meristem, as a meristematic tissue, is comprised of undifferentiated (others, partially differentiated), embryonic cells. They are actively dividing cells, with thin walls and large nuclei. These cells do not form secondary cell wall thickenings, and therefore have only primary cell walls.

There are three types of tissue systems: dermal, vascular, and ground. Dermal tissue is composed of epidermis and periderm. Epidermis is a thin cell layer that covers and protects underlying cells. They also produce cells that develop into … safari ltd weaselWeb20 mei 2024 · The periderm acts as armor protecting the plant's inner tissues from biotic and abiotic stress. It forms during the radial thickening of plant organs such as stems and roots and replaces the function of primary protective tissues such as the epidermis and the endodermis.
